We are trying to make a board, using a matrix with numbers 0, 1 and 2. How can we specified the color of each number in the board using image?

You can treat the matrix created as an indexed image and use ind2rgb after defining a custom colormap with 3 levels (one for each value). A small example is shown below for setting the value of 0 to red, 1 to green and 2 to blue.
num = randi(3,100)-1;%randi generates integers from 1-3.
map = [1 0 0
0 1 0
0 0 1];
rgbImage = ind2rgb(num+1, map);
imagesc(rgbImage)
